If you’re new around here, hi! I am Fran, I’m the founder, designer, and maker behind Noosa Collection.
Honestly, this whole journey started as a quiet little creative outlet during my postpartum time. Spending so much time at home with 2 babies made me realize how much I needed my space to feel like a sanctuary—a place that feels warm, comforting, and somewhere you truly love being.
I wanted vibrant floral touches to bring life into my home, but fresh flowers fade so quickly, and all the long-lasting options were dull, brown dried flowers. I craved bright, fresh-looking color! That’s how I fell in love with preserved flowers. I actually spent a full year experimenting with the art of preserving them myself—which was super challenging! Eventually, I realized as a business owner you have to pick your battles, so now I leave the preserving to my amazing flower suppliers so I can focus full-time on designing, creating, and running everything else.
Fast forward to today, and I’m so proud of how far we’ve come:
🌿 Made with so much love: Every piece is crafted mostly with Australian native botanicals, toxic-free scents, and wrapped up in eco-friendly packaging that you can reuse, compost, or recycle.
📜 Truly one-of-a-kind: Designed to last for years, featuring unique, original designs I spent months experimenting on that are now officially patented with IP Design Australia.
🌸 Built on your love: We’re stocked in 20+ lovely stores across Australia and New Zealand, growing 100% through word of mouth. No paid ads, just your amazing support!
🛍️ Market Saturdays: You can catch me every Saturday at the Eumundi Markets! Getting to chat with you face-to-face is honestly my absolute favourite part of the week.
✈️ Spreading around the world: It blows my mind that so many of you have packed our delicate glass lamps and lightbulbs right into your check in luggage to take to different countries. Thank you so much for taking that risk and bringing these fragile treasures across the globe!
